| Parameter | Symbol | Min | Typ | Max | Unit | |-----------|--------|-----|-----|-----|------| | Reverse Stand-off Voltage | V_RWM | - | 2.0 | 2.0 | V | | Breakdown Voltage (I_T = 1mA) | V_BR | 2.2 | 2.4 | 2.6 | V | | Test Current for V_BR | I_T | 1.0 | - | - | mA | | Maximum Clamping Voltage (I_PP = 50A) | V_C | - | 3.4 | 3.8 | V | | Reverse Leakage Current (at V_RWM) | I_R | - | 5 | 20 | μA | | Junction Capacitance (at 0V, 1MHz) | C_J | - | 1200 | 1500 | pF |
Critical note: The high junction capacitance (≈1200pF) makes the VPM2SM unsuitable for high-speed data lines (e.g., USB 2.0, Ethernet). Use low-capacitance TVS arrays for those applications. The VPM2SM is designed for "bulletproof" reliability in
